Do I need to make reservations for Louvre and Rodin Museum

I read that you need reservations for the Uffizi museum in florence. Do I need them for any of these two or any other of the common sightseeing in Paris? <BR><BR>Thanks

Nope, you don't need them at either. Both are covered by the Paris Museum Card, so if you're planning on buying the card you can avoid any lines. Otherwise, you really shouldn't have to wait at Rodin because it's so small and not too crowded. You'll probably wait in line a bit at the Louvre, but shouldn't be too crazy - I think we waited about 20 minutes.<BR>Kimberley

No reservations needed. Actually I don't think it's even possible to do so. The Museum Card, which can be purchased for different durations (1-day, 3-days, etc), IS worthwhile. There's a website that lists all the museums for which you can access --- www.musee.??? Key in "Paris Museum Card" in your browser & you'll pull it up. The card can be purchased at any of the museums that honor it OR also can be bought at most of the metro stops. <BR>
